Description Marcin 2011-05-01 12:05:24 UTC
I've just updated vte, and now, when i run gnome-terminal i got this error: Failed to load terminal capabilities from '/etc/termcap'. Also 'Enter' key doesn't work.

Comment 1 Hans de Graaff gentoo-dev Security 2011-05-02 05:54:34 UTC
This appears to happen because the termcap path changed. The solution is to stop all your terminal applications that use vte, and restart them. With gnome-terminal it's not enough to just start a new one because that will attach to the already running process.
Comment 2 Gilles Dartiguelongue (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2011-05-02 09:24:23 UTC
killall gnome-terminal and restart a new instance of the application.
Older upgrades did this as well, not a bug.
